Matthew 10:26
In the time of judgment everything is made plain. He does not attend to abuses, but to the hearts.

About this text
Catena fragments on Matthew (CPG 5206). Contents follow Matthew chapter and verse. Edition fragment numbers stay in About this text and under each passage.
English follows the named copy-text (Aegean/khazarzar Migne PG 72 extract). Other prints were checked as noted; no silent merge of recensions.
Witnesses
- Copy-text Migne PG 72 Commentarii in Matthaeum (Aegean Digital Patrologia / khazarzar) (Greek · CPG 5206 catena fragments (290 parsed heads))
- Checked print matia.gr mirror of same Aegean extract (Greek · Byte-identical PDF; integrity check only)
- Checked print Internet Archive PG 72 volume OCR (bim … 1859_72) (Greek (OCR damaged) · Locus confirmation only; not used as reading text)
English is newly prepared for study from the stated edition. Open Greek on each section for the source text. This is not a complete critical edition.
